Common Causes of Leg Weakness
Leg weakness isn't a disease in itself, but rather a symptom. Identifying the root cause is crucial for proper diagnosis and treatment. Here are some of the most frequent culprits:
1. Neurological Disorders
The nervous system plays a vital role in transmitting signals from the brain to the muscles, enabling movement. When these pathways are disrupted, leg weakness can occur. Some prominent neurological conditions include:
- Multiple Sclerosis (MS): This chronic autoimmune disease affects the central nervous system, including the brain and spinal cord. It damages the myelin sheath, which protects nerve fibers. This damage can lead to a wide range of symptoms, with leg weakness being a very common early sign. Patients may experience stiffness, fatigue, and difficulty with balance and coordination in addition to weakness.
- Amyotrophic Lateral Sclerosis (ALS), also known as Lou Gehrig's Disease: ALS is a progressive neurodegenerative disease that affects nerve cells in the brain and spinal cord. This leads to muscle weakness, twitching, and eventually paralysis. Leg weakness is often one of the first noticeable symptoms, making walking and standing difficult.
- Parkinson's Disease: While commonly associated with tremors, Parkinson's disease also causes rigidity and slowness of movement. Leg weakness, stiffness, and a shuffling gait are frequently observed, particularly in the early stages.
- Peripheral Neuropathy: This occurs when nerves outside of the brain and spinal cord are damaged. Causes are varied, including diabetes, vitamin deficiencies, infections, and autoimmune disorders. Symptoms often begin in the feet and legs, with tingling, numbness, and a sensation of weakness.
- Stroke: A stroke occurs when blood supply to a part of the brain is interrupted, causing brain cells to die. Depending on the area of the brain affected, stroke can lead to sudden and significant weakness or paralysis in one or both legs.
- Spinal Cord Injury or Compression: Any damage or pressure on the spinal cord can disrupt nerve signals to the legs. This can be due to trauma, herniated discs, tumors, or inflammation. The severity of weakness depends on the location and extent of the spinal cord involvement.
2. Musculoskeletal Issues
Problems within the muscles, bones, and joints of the legs can also lead to a feeling of weakness:
- Muscle Atrophy: This is the wasting away of muscle tissue, often due to disuse, aging (sarcopenia), or certain medical conditions. When leg muscles weaken, it directly translates to reduced strength and mobility.
- Arthritis: Conditions like osteoarthritis and rheumatoid arthritis can cause inflammation and pain in the joints of the legs. This pain can make it difficult and uncomfortable to bear weight or move the legs, leading to a perception of weakness.
- Muscle Strain or Tear: An acute injury to a leg muscle can result in pain, swelling, and a sudden loss of strength.
- Electrolyte Imbalances: Imbalances in electrolytes such as potassium, calcium, and magnesium can affect muscle function and lead to weakness, including in the legs.
3. Vascular Conditions
Adequate blood flow is essential for muscle function. Problems with circulation can cause weakness:
- Peripheral Artery Disease (PAD): This condition occurs when arteries that supply blood to the legs become narrowed or blocked, usually by plaque buildup. It can cause pain, cramping, and weakness in the legs, especially during activity (claudication). This is often described as a "tired" or "heavy" feeling in the legs.
- Deep Vein Thrombosis (DVT): A DVT is a blood clot in a deep vein, usually in the leg. While pain and swelling are common, some individuals may experience a general feeling of heaviness and weakness in the affected leg.
4. Other Medical Conditions
Several other conditions can contribute to leg weakness:
- Chronic Fatigue Syndrome (CFS) / Myalgic Encephalomyelitis (ME): This complex disorder is characterized by extreme fatigue that is not relieved by rest. Muscle weakness, including in the legs, is a common symptom, often exacerbated by physical or mental exertion.
- Anemia: A lack of red blood cells or hemoglobin can reduce the amount of oxygen delivered to the body's tissues, leading to general fatigue and weakness, which can be felt in the legs.
- Infections: Certain infections, such as the flu or Lyme disease, can cause generalized body aches and weakness, which may include the legs.
- Medication Side Effects: Some medications, including certain statins, diuretics, and chemotherapy drugs, can have leg weakness as a side effect.
- Vitamin D Deficiency: Vitamin D is important for muscle health. A significant deficiency can contribute to muscle weakness and pain, particularly in the legs.
When to Seek Medical Attention
Leg weakness can be a concerning symptom. It's important to consult a healthcare professional if you experience any of the following:
- Sudden onset of leg weakness.
- Weakness that is severe or progressively worsening.
- Weakness accompanied by numbness, tingling, or loss of sensation.
- Weakness associated with difficulty controlling bowel or bladder function.
- Weakness following an injury.
- Leg weakness that significantly impacts your daily activities.
A doctor will perform a thorough physical examination, ask about your medical history, and may order tests such as blood work, nerve conduction studies, electromyography (EMG), or imaging scans to determine the cause of your leg weakness.
Diagnosis and Treatment
The diagnostic process typically involves a combination of:
- Medical History: Detailed questions about your symptoms, their onset, duration, and any associated factors.
- Physical Examination: Assessing your muscle strength, reflexes, sensation, coordination, and gait.
- Neurological Examination: Evaluating your nervous system function.
- Blood Tests: To check for infections, vitamin deficiencies, electrolyte imbalances, and markers of inflammation.
- Imaging Scans: MRI or CT scans to visualize the brain, spinal cord, or muscles for abnormalities.
- Electrophysiological Tests: EMG and nerve conduction studies to assess nerve and muscle function.
Treatment strategies are highly dependent on the underlying cause. They can range from:
- Medications: To manage inflammation, pain, nerve damage, or underlying conditions like MS or Parkinson's.
- Physical Therapy: To strengthen muscles, improve balance, and enhance mobility.
- Lifestyle Modifications: Such as diet changes, exercise (as appropriate), and managing chronic conditions.
- Surgery: In cases of spinal compression or severe vascular blockages.
- Assistive Devices: Such as canes or walkers, to aid with mobility.

Can leg weakness be a sign of a stroke?
Yes, sudden onset of leg weakness, especially if it affects one side of the body or is accompanied by other stroke symptoms like facial drooping or slurred speech, can be a critical sign of a stroke. Prompt medical attention is vital in such cases.
Is leg weakness always a sign of a serious disease?
Not necessarily. Leg weakness can be caused by temporary factors like fatigue, dehydration, or overexertion. However, persistent or sudden leg weakness warrants a medical evaluation to rule out serious underlying conditions.
